Output d6953cddd73072e08f8c23d0392134b0783496a1057c2a17eb9881fab260a450:0

value
18121758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24efb32cbbb52de8ee411e5afb66d60f39ffec23 OP_EQUALVERIFY OP_CHECKSIG
address
14NJUYjA7xk3Rs5WWHn62HrmHhHdEmdYBG
transaction
d6953cddd73072e08f8c23d0392134b0783496a1057c2a17eb9881fab260a450
spent
true